How Many Hens Can One Rooster Live With Safely?

WebMar 13, 2024 · As they can mate between 10 and 30 times a day, a rooster in his prime can manage a flock of 20 but will struggle to fertilize them all. The rooster’s limitation isn’t too much of a problem if you only want eggs. But, if you’re trying to breed, it could throw a spanner in the works. Least compatible: … WebJan 26, 2024 · Roosters can start mating at 4 months of age, while hens will start at around 5 months. This can vary, though, and peak reproductive ability isn’t reached for some time after (until a bird is around eight months of age). It’s important to note that heritage breeds tend to reach maturity later.

WebMar 3, 2024 · Roosters and hens both have cloacas, but there are anatomical differences between them that allow mating to take place. Roosters do not have a penis. (Yes, this a very common question!) The male has a papilla, which is a small bump that the rooster can push out and use to deliver sperm into the female’s cloaca, also called a vent.
